Analog Devices Inc./Maxim Integrated's MAX159ACPA- is a 10-bit, successive approximation register (SAR) analog-to-digital converter (ADC). This device features a single pseudo-differential input channel and a 1:1 ratio for sample-and-hold to ADC. It offers an SPI data interface and requires an external reference voltage. The MAX159ACPA- operates with analog and digital supply voltages ranging from 2.7V to 5.25V and achieves a sampling rate of up to 108kSPS. Packaged in an 8-pin PDIP, this component is suitable for through-hole mounting. It finds application in various industrial and consumer electronics segments requiring precise analog signal conversion.
